It’s likely that the controller you’re speaking to is new too at a smaller airport, At least for your clearance or ground. Don’t be nervous, we all were nervous to begin with. Just know who you are and what you want to do. Also, if they ask for aircraft type, they want the designator not the name. I.E a C172 not a Skyhawk.

Yes, but keep in mind that 123ATC was last updated in February. The facilities will not be accurate as far as staffing. The facility I would like to go to is staffed at 70% projected and in February it was 94%.

That may be good or bad news. However, while you’re at the academy, you can check the active list. Most people don’t recommend it because you don’t need to worry about that, just focus on the class. But it’s a good way to pass free time towards the end of the day.

The academy is tough. It is like going to work with your friends. Class is mildly stressful but at times it is fun for basics. The instructors are pretty laid back. Alot of the academy is self discipline. It’s not like a prison but you need to conduct yourself in a professional manner at all times (you’re a probationary employee, you’ll hear a lot of examples on how to ruin your chances there on your first day). When you get there make friends with your whole class, they’ll be most valuable resource.
